3LW1
Binary complex of 14-3-3 sigma and p53 pT387-peptide
Experimental procedure
| Experimental method | SINGLE WAVELENGTH |
| Source type | SYNCHROTRON |
| Source details | SLS BEAMLINE X10SA |
| Synchrotron site | SLS |
| Beamline | X10SA |
| Temperature [K] | 100 |
| Detector technology | CCD |
| Collection date | 2009-02-16 |
| Detector | MARMOSAIC 225 mm CCD |
| Wavelength(s) | 0.85 |
| Spacegroup name | C 2 2 21 |
| Unit cell lengths | 82.320, 112.320, 62.660 |
| Unit cell angles | 90.00, 90.00, 90.00 |
Refinement procedure
| Resolution | 45.570 - 1.280 |
| R-factor | 0.128 |
| Rwork | 0.126 |
| R-free | 0.15100 |
| Structure solution method | MOLECULAR REPLACEMENT |
| Starting model (for MR) | 1ywt |
| RMSD bond length | 0.021 |
| RMSD bond angle | 2.029 |
| Data reduction software | XDS |
| Data scaling software | XSCALE |
| Phasing software | PHASER |
| Refinement software | REFMAC (5.5.0109) |

Crystallization Conditions
| crystal ID | method | pH | temperature | details |
| 1 | VAPOR DIFFUSION, HANGING DROP | 7.5 | 277 | 0.1M HEPES, 0.2M calcium chloride, 28% PEG 400, 5% glycerol, 2mM DTT, pH 7.5, VAPOR DIFFUSION, HANGING DROP, temperature 277K |
